Strategies for Effective Overseas News Releases
To maximize the impact of overseas news releases, brands should focus on several key strategies:
1. Tailored Content: Develop content that resonates with local cultural nuances and consumer preferences.
2. Multi-Channel Approach: Utilize a combination of traditional media outlets, social media platforms, and influencer partnerships.
3. Timely Messaging: Align release timing with relevant events or trends in the target market.
4. Engagement: Foster ongoing dialogue with consumers through comments sections, social media interactions, and customer feedback.
By implementing these strategies, brands can effectively leverage overseas news release channels to achieve their internationalization goals.
